f. Description of the Invention
In a turbocharged engine ,exhaust energy of the engine is used to drive turbine,which drives the compressor.The
compressor pushes more air into the engine which produces more work.
But at low engine rpm,turbine is not able to produce enough work at low engine rpm as the exhaust gas energy is not
powerful enough to drive turbine.This problem can be reduced or eliminated by the use of variable geometry turbine.
Thus the performance of turbine can be improved by using variable geometry turbine.

6. ABSTRACT OF THE INVENTION
Turbocharging is an important technology not only to boost engine power ,but it is currently being used by automobile
manufacturers to meet Euro standards of emission.
But one of the problems faced in a turbocharged engine is that of pronounced turbolag that is experienced at low
rpm,because the turbine is not able to produce enough work at low engine rpm as the exhaust gas energy is not powerful
enough to drive turbine.This problem can be reduced or eliminated by the use of variable geometry turbine
In variable geometry turbine,angles of the nozzle blades are changed as per the mass flow rate and work required bycompressor.
Our aim is to design VGT ,analyse it and compare results with conventional turbine.
